What is a Percentage?
A percentage is a way of expressing a value as a fraction of 100. It is denoted by the symbol "%". For example, 25% is equal to .
Converting a Fraction to a Percentage
To convert a fraction to a percentage, we need to divide the numerator by the denominator and multiply the result by 100.

Q: Can I convert a decimal to a percentage?
A: Yes, you can convert a decimal to a percentage by multiplying it by 100.
